The Greatest Guide To what is md5's application
The Greatest Guide To what is md5's application
Blog Article
As chances are you'll previously know, most passwords are saved hashed through the developers of the favorites Sites. This means they don’t keep the password you selected inside of a simple textual content variety, they convert it into A different price, a illustration of this password. But in the process, can two passwords contain the exact hash illustration? That’s…
Should you remember what we talked over At the beginning in the input M portion, each 512 block of enter is divided up into sixteen 32-bit “words”, labelled M0-M15.
Prolonged and Protected Salt: Ensure that the salt is extended ample (not less than sixteen bytes) and generated using a cryptographically secure random amount generator.
MD5 processes input info in 512-bit blocks, executing numerous rounds of bitwise operations. It generates a fixed 128-bit output, regardless of the input size. These functions make sure even small changes in the input generate appreciably distinctive hash values.
Password Protection: bcrypt is specially suitable for protected password storage and is considered the business conventional for this objective. It makes certain that even if the password hashes are compromised, it’s extremely difficult for attackers to crack the passwords.
Training and Consciousness: Educate personnel with regard to the risks affiliated with out-of-date protection methods and the significance of staying current with industry most effective tactics.
Click the Duplicate to Clipboard button and paste into your web page to more info routinely add this site content to your site
The result moves onto another box, where it truly is included to a part of the enter, represented by Mi. Just after this, a constant, K, is additional to The end result, utilizing the exact same Specific style of addition. The values for K are is derived from the method:
Stability Greatest Methods: Employing these possibilities aligns with modern-day safety most effective procedures, making sure that your units and info keep on being safe during the confront of subtle attacks.
Determining the right values for each in the preceding sixteen operations doesn’t sound extremely entertaining, so We'll just make some up as an alternative.
Most effective Procedures: Cryptographic very best tactics now advise using more robust algorithms, such as bcrypt and Argon2, for password hashing because of their resistance to brute power and dictionary assaults.
Up to now we’ve only finished our very first calculation. Have a look at the diagram to check out where by we are heading:
The commonest application of your MD5 algorithm is currently to check information integrity after a transfer. By generating a MD5 file right before and following a file transfer, it’s probable to detect any corruption. MD5 is also nonetheless used to shop passwords in some databases, even when it’s no longer safe.
bcrypt: Exclusively created for password hashing, bcrypt incorporates salting and multiple rounds of hashing to shield towards brute-pressure and rainbow table attacks.